There must be a few of you out there who play Championship Manager 3? Well, version 3.9.65 is out with a whole 10 MB database update AND they fixed that annoying eternal "processing data" error.

Say, does anyone know what happened to the backround pictures of local stadiums that I saw in the PeeCee version of the game? I really miss seeing Highbury when playing home
